Dunsmuir High School is one such institution with a story that begins more than a century ago. Established in 1911, the school’s first classes were held in a simple home site, a humble start for what would become a cornerstone of education in the region. Over time, the vision for the school expanded along with the needs of its students. Today, Dunsmuir High School stands on 165 acres of forested land, a campus that reflects both its roots and its commitment to growth.
The two-story building houses 11 classrooms, a computer lab, a library, a multi-media arts studio, a woodshop, a weight room, and a gymnasium. Academic Excellence in a Close-Knit Community
Dunsmuir High School is part of a unique single-school district that serves grades nine through twelve within the city of Dunsmuir. This structure allows the school to maintain a close connection with its students and community, ensuring that every learner receives the attention and support they need. With smaller class sizes and a dedicated staff, education here feels personal. Teachers know their students by name, and learning becomes a shared journey rather than a routine process.
Academically, Dunsmuir High School blends tradition with innovation. The school offers on-campus, in-person college preparatory courses designed to prepare students for higher education while developing critical thinking and problem-solving skills. College and career support is available through partnerships such as Upward Bound at Simpson University, helping students plan their paths beyond graduation.
Students also benefit from concurrent enrollment opportunities through the College of the Siskiyous, allowing them to earn college credits while still in high school. For those seeking flexible learning options, online coursework is available through Edgenuity, expanding access to specialized subjects and independent study.
Beyond academics, Dunsmuir High School provides Career Technical Education (CTE) Pathway courses that reflect real-world skills and local opportunities. Programs in Culinary Arts, Computer Science, and Construction Trades give students hands-on experience in growing industries. Leadership with Vision and Heart
At the center of Dunsmuir High School’s continued success is a leadership team that values both tradition and progress. Superintendent Ray Kellar has long been a guiding force in shaping the school’s culture of care, community, and academic excellence. Having served as Superintendent and Principal until June 30, 2025, his leadership has been defined by a deep understanding of what it means to nurture students in a small-town setting where every individual matters.
As he transitions into retirement, his influence continues to echo through the halls and hearts of the Dunsmuir community. Under his guidance, the school strengthened its academic offerings, modernized facilities, and reinforced the belief that education is not just about textbooks, but about personal growth and community connection.
Taking up the mantle of Principal is Jacob Mekeel, who brings a fresh perspective and a shared commitment to the school’s vision. A Vibrant Campus Life that Encourages Growth
Life at Dunsmuir High School is full of energy, teamwork, and creativity. The campus offers students a balance of academics and activities that help them grow into confident, well-rounded individuals. Sports play a big part in this experience. Students take pride in representing the school in football, volleyball, basketball, golf, tennis, baseball, and softball. Each sport teaches discipline, leadership, and the value of working toward a shared goal.
Beyond athletics, Dunsmuir High School provides a variety of clubs that encourage students to explore their interests and develop new skills. From chess and robotics to art, music, and the Tiger Community Outreach program, every student can find a place where they belong. These clubs bring students together to learn, create, and make a difference in their community.
The school also runs an after-school program designed to support both academic and social development. It offers tutoring, classroom assistance, and additional club activities that give students extra opportunities to learn and connect.

A Team That Leads with Care and Purpose
At Dunsmuir High School, leadership feels personal. The school operates with a small but deeply dedicated team that functions more like a family than an institution. At the head of this close-knit group is the Superintendent and Principal, supported by a Lead Teacher, seven additional teachers, two custodian-drivers, and two office staff members. Comprehensive Student Support and Enrichment
Dunsmuir High School goes beyond academics to provide a wide range of support and enrichment opportunities that help students explore their interests and plan for the future. The school organizes annual college tours, typically lasting three days and including visits to four to six campuses, giving students firsthand exposure to higher education options. On-campus college and career fairs, as well as local campus visits, provide additional guidance and networking opportunities.
Students also participate in workshops, Upward Bound trips, and athletic events at both professional and college levels. Cultural experiences, such as trips to the Ashland Shakespearean Theater, and community service projects, connect learning with real-world experiences. STEM events, forestry challenges, and fun activities like water park visits or programs with local elementary schools ensure a balance of engagement, skill-building, and enjoyment. Looking Ahead: Preparing Students for Lifelong Success
Dunsmuir High School is focused on expanding opportunities that prepare students for life beyond graduation. One of the school’s key initiatives in recent years has been the growth of concurrent enrollment programs with local colleges. These programs allow students to earn college credit while completing their high school education, giving them a head start on higher education. Some students leave high school with a semester or even a full year of college completed, and currently, two sophomores aim to graduate with an associate degree alongside their high school diploma.
